| Located
on Lake Hartwell, Camp Rotary provides year
round "primitive" camping. This
25 acre camp on the lake was built with funds
raised by the Rotary Club of Hartwell, Georgia.
|
| Program Facilities
-- 15 campsites
-- Large shelter
-- Swimming dock
-- Council ring for campfires

Reservations
Camp Rotary is available for unit camping year-round.
To make reservations for weekend use of Camp
Rotary, fill out the reservation form (currently
available at each of the council Service Centers
or download
it here) and
send it to the Camping Department at the Jefferson
Service Center.
Questions concerning camp facilities or availability
should be directed to the Camping Department.
Directions
Camp Rotary is located near I-85 in north Georgia.
From the First Baptist Church in Hartwell (intersction
of Route 29 and Route 51 North):
-- Take 51 North (Chandler St) for 6.9 miles to
the stop sign at Reed Creek Baptist Church.
-- Turn right and continue 1 mile to Crawford
Ferry Road.
-- Turn left and continue 1.2 miles to Rainbow
Drive (the first paved road to the right,
first right after passing Lindy Lane). -- Turn right
and proceed 1 mile to the camp entrance.
